Why in news?

  • The European Organization for Nuclear Research (CERN) has reignited the Large Hadron Collider for the third time in July2022 — 10 years after it enabled scientists to find the ‘God particle’ or Higgs Boson.

About Large Hadron Collider:

  • The Large Hadron Collider is a giant, complex machine built to study particles that are the smallest known building blocks of all things.
  • In its operational state, it fires two beams of protons almost at the speed of light in opposite directions inside a ring of superconducting electromagnets.
  • The magnetic field created by the superconducting electromagnets keeps the protons in a tight beam and guides them along the way as they travel through beam pipes and finally collide.
  • LHC’s powerful electromagnets carry almost as much current as a bolt of lightning; they must be kept chilled.
  • The LHC uses a distribution system of liquid helium to keep its critical components ultracold at minus 271.3 degrees Celsius, which is colder than interstellar space.

Significance:

  • Physicists want to use the collisions to learn more about the Universe at the smallest scales, and to solve mysteries such as the nature of dark matter.
  • The LHC's goal is to allow physicists to test the predictions of different theories of particle physics.
  • Technology found in particle accelerators is already used for certain types of cancer surgery etc.

Add ons:

  • First Run:
    • A decade ago, CERN had announced to the world the discovery of the Higgs boson or the ‘God Particle’ during the LHC’s first run.
  • Second Run:
    • It began in 2015 and lasted till 2018. The second season of data taking produced five times more data than Run 1.
